fotonovela
noun
/foʊtəˈnoʊvəˌlɑː/

Definition
A fotonovela is a type of entertainment that combines photography and a serialized narrative, often resembling a comic book or a graphic novel.

Meaning
The term fotonovela comes from the Spanish words ‘foto’ meaning ‘photo’ and ‘novela’ meaning ‘novel’. It typically features a sequence of photographs telling a story, usually accompanied by dialogue in the form of captions or speech bubbles.
